Weibo Corp (WB) operates one of China’s largest social media platforms, combining microblogging, short video, live streaming and e-commerce features. Investors should know Weibo earns most revenue from advertising, marketing services and platform-based value-added offerings; partnerships with influencers and merchants can boost monetisation. The company faces both growth opportunities — such as increased digital ad spend and commerce integration — and notable risks, including intense competition from other Chinese apps, shifting user behaviour and regulatory oversight in China. Its market capitalisation (~$2.69bn) places it in the small‑cap category, which can mean greater share-price volatility.
